Web8 iul. 2024 · If Chrome has crashed so badly that it won’t quit, you’ll need to Force Quit. There are two ways to do that: Click on the Apple menu, choose Force Quit, and then choose Chrome in the window that opens, then Force Quit. Press Command-Option-Escape, then Chrome, then press Force Quit. Once it has quit, you can restart Chrome.

Web13 apr. 2024 · If your Mac keeps shutting down, here is how to reset the SMC: Turn off your Mac. Press and hold the left Control + Option keys and the right Shift key for 7 seconds.
